Roasted Delight: Your Go-to Gluten-Free and Dairy-Free Meal

Serves 2

Ingredients:

  • 12 oz Market Side® Butternut Squash (340g), kosher salt
  • Black pepper powder
  • 1 Market Side® Traditional Chicken, Dark Meat
  • 2 cups Tomato Salad (400g)
  • 1/4 cup Red Wine Vinaigrette (60 ml)
  • 1 lb Zucchini (455g), roasted

Nutritional Information

  • Calories: 533
  • Fat: 24g
  • Carbohydrates: 36g
  • Fiber: 8g
  • Sugar: 14g
  • Protein: 46g

Preparation

  1. Poke several holes into the Butternut Squash packaging using a fork.
  2. Microwave the package for 2-4 minutes or until the squash is soft.
  3. Season the Butternut Squash with salt and black pepper.
  4. Separate the drumsticks and thighs from the chicken.
  5. Drizzle the Tomato Salad with vinaigrette.
  6. Place the roasted Butternut Squash, Tomato Salad, and Zucchini next to the chicken on a plate.
